Zelna M. Lowe's Obituary
Zelna Lucas Lowe 93 of Decatur died at 12:15 pm March 15, 2004 in her home.

Zelna was born on August 21, 1910 in Waterloo, IA the daughter of Miles Wesley and Mollie Sievers Lucas. She married Morris W. Lowe on December 9, 1939 in Decatur.
Mrs. Lowe was a musician and teacher. She taught piano privately in her home and in the Preparatory Department at Millikin University School of Music. She was a graduate of Millikin University class of 1936. She was a member of Sigma Alpha Iota. Zelna also was an accompanist and was organist at First Presbyterian Church for 55 years.
Surviving are her sons, Michael W. Lowe of Decatur; Lynn C. Lowe and wife Kathleen Ziak Lowe of Warren, RI and Ft. Lauderdale, FL; and Mark S. Lowe of West Hollywood, CA; grandchildren, Elizabeth, Andrew, and Matthew, and a great-grandchild Molly.
She was preceded in death by her parents, husband, a brother, Francis W. Lucas, and a sister, Helen Lucas Horton.
